The Cuddalore Police has started investigation in this case related to the student. Police said a Class 11 student of a government school near Chidambaram in Tamil Nadu gave birth to a child and dumped the baby’s body near the school’s toilet. Police have started investigation as to who made the minor pregnant.
Dead newborn thrown near toilet
The school authorities found the child’s body near the school’s toilet on Thursday and informed the Bhuvanagiri police. The police launched an investigation and on Friday evening they found the girl who admitted that she had given birth to the child. She said that she felt pain and went to the toilet and gave birth to the child. While the girl said that the child was born dead, the police said that she would have died as she gave birth to him without any help.

Police said the girl cut the umbilical cord with a pen and returned to class. The girl also told the police that she did not tell anyone in the school or family that she was pregnant. Police is questioning several people including her relatives and local people to find out the person who made her pregnant.
